The strategy for Ukraine's Donbas region is to gradually withdraw while causing the highest possible losses to Russia.


Throughout the year, Ukraine has faced significant losses in its eastern Donbas region to Russia, with cities and towns falling after prolonged battles. Despite appearing to cede territory, Ukrainian commanders emphasize a strategy of attrition to exhaust Russian forces. Russia's military advantage in size and firepower poses challenges for Ukraine, leading to a tactical retreat to minimize losses. The conflict, marked by brutal assaults and urban combat, is a test of endurance for both sides. As Ukraine aims to wear down Russia's resources, the outcome remains uncertain given Moscow's resilience and ongoing support for the war.
